iQOO Neo3 appears in an official video, punch hole display confirmed

vivo sub-brand iQOO will unveil the iQOO Neo3 on April 23, and the company is delivering frequent teasers to keep up the hype. The latest bit is a short video on Weibo to boast about the speed of the Neo3, which also reveals the front side of the smartphone and confirms it will pack a punch hole display. Previously, the company confirmed that Neo3 will pack a 144Hz screen. We don't get to see the rear of the Neo3 in this video, but we assume it will be similar to the iQOO 3's which was unveiled back in February. You can watch the clip below. Motorola Edge stops by Geekbench ahead of its April 22 announcement

Motorola is officially getting back into the flagship smartphone game with an announcement on April 22. At that point, rumor has it we'll be introduced to the top of the line Edge+, as well as the slightly lower-end (but with what will hopefully be a more palatable price point) Edge. The former has already been spotted in the Geekbench database back in January, while the vanilla Edge took its sweet time but finally arrived there today. Redmi Air Dots S go official

Xiaomi subsidiary Redmi released its latest Air Dots S TWS earbuds in China earlier today. The new model does not bring any visual changes but offers a new mono sound output mode which can split the two earbuds as separate receivers. The Air Dots S are also touted to offer better sound transmission rates despite the fact they still rely on Bluetooth 5.0 connectivity just like their predecessors. OnePlus Bullets Wireless Z have arrived, packing even more battery

As expected the OnePlus 8 and OnePlus 8 Pro were joined on stage by the new Bullets Wireless Z headphones. They feature an impressive $49.95 price tag - half the going rate of the Bullets Wireless 2. Rumors of 20 hours of playback time on a single charge were confirmed as well. Plus, the Warp Charge support means you can get up to 10 hours of playback with just 10 minutes of charging. The Bullets Wireless Z support Magnetic Controls for pausing and resuming music, when the two buds get attached and detached from one another. iQOO Neo3 will be the cheapest Snapdragon 865-powered smartphone

It's known for a while now that iQOO, vivo's sub-brand, is preparing to launch a more affordable version of the recently announced iQOO 3 smartphone called iQOO Neo3. It will be announced on April 23 and now the latest leak reveals a bit more about its pricing. According to a Weibo post, the handset will start at CNY 2,998 (€390) making it the most affordable Snapdragon 865-powered smartphone essentially matching the Redmi K30 Pro (CNY2,999). All Lenovo Legion versions will come with 90W charging

Lenovo's official Weibo account went on a spree today promoting the Legion gaming smartphone, releasing released two more hints about the fast charging capabilities of the handset. For one it dispersed rumors that the 90W charging tipped yesterday was actually a marketing gimmick where the PR people would sum wired and wireless charging to come to that number. The company further confirmed that the unprecedented charging speed will be available on all versions of the Legio phone, rather than just a Pro edition. Razer unveils Pikachu themed TWS earphones with Poke ball case

Back in October, Razer unveiled its first entry into the true wireless (TWS) earphones market with the Hammerhead TWS earphones. Now, the gamer-centric company is back with a more colorful Pokemon-themed version complete with a Poke ball-shaped charging case. The limited-edition earphones sport a yellow coat of paint complete with a Pikachu logo in place of the Razer one. Other than the altered visual appearance, the headphones are identical to the Hammerhead which means 13mm drivers, Bluetooth 5.0 connectivity with a special gaming mode which offers 60ms latency. vivo X30 gets a new Rainbow Shadow color variant

The vivo X30 unveiled last December in Black, Peach and Light Blue shades gets a new gradient paint job - Rainbow Shadow. As already evident from the name, the Rainbow Shadow variant is inspired by the rainbow, and while it does look similar to the Light Blue version, it actually changes colors to pink, orange, blue and green when you look at it at different angles, which is possible due to the AG frosting process.
